WebHow Long Can an Alligator Live? Alligators have fairly long lifespans; they live about 30 to 50 years on average. Of course, this is just an average range; some alligators die much earlier in life, while others live much longer. Alligators can live to be 80 years old or more. Alligators are native to only the United States, Mexico, and China. American alligators are found in the southeast United States: all of Florida and Louisiana; the southern parts of Georgia, Alabama, and Mississippi; coastal South and North Carolina; East Texas, the southeast corner of Oklahoma, and the southern tip of Arkansas. WebWhere do Alligators Live? There are two kinds of alligators in the world: American and Chinese. The first type is found in the Southeastern United States, while the second type lives in Eastern China. WebMar 3, 2024 · A large variety of crocodilian fossils have been discovered that date back 200 million years to the Late Triassic Epoch. Fossil evidence also suggests that three major radiations occurred. Only one of the four suborders of crocodiles has survived to modern times. The order Crocodylia includes the “true crocodiles,” alligators, caimans, and gavials.

Adult male alligators occasionally reach 13 to 15 feet in length. Maximum length for females is approximately 10 feet. Both sexes tend to be smaller in South Florida.
